You Waited
Travis Greene's song 'You Waited' reflects on God's patient love and grace. The lyrics describe how God reached out, called the singer by name, and covered their shame despite their past. The repeated question 'Where would I be if You left me God?' emphasizes gratitude for God's faithfulness. The song centers on the theme of God waiting for the individual, highlighting personal redemption and the transformative power of grace. It connects to the biblical idea of God's relentless pursuit of His people, similar to the parable of the lost sheep.
